Successfully represented the widow and teenaged daughter of a man killed three days after Christmas by a drunk driver on an interstate.  The victim and his daughter were in route to attend a sporting event.  The civil action was brought against the drunk driver as well as against the bar that had served the driver alcohol in violation of Georgia's dram shop laws.  The case settled through mediation.
